Kiểm tra php không null

Có tường hợp isset($var) trả về TRUE nhưng trống($var) trả về FALSE. Vì thế trong quá trình thiết lập các điều kiện biểu thức điều kiện cần xác định rõ để tạo biểu thức thích hợp

Ví dụ

Hàm trống() được sử dụng trong trường hợp nào

  • Sử dụng để kiểm tra giá trị biến xem có trống hay không

  • Phục vụ cho trình Chuẩn hóa dữ liệu khi thao tác đến nhận giá trị từ Biểu mẫu

liên kết url

http. //hocweb123. com/ham-trống-trong-php. html

  • Trang chủ
  • HƯỚNG DẪN HỌC
  • Học PHP
  • Kiểu dữ liệu trong PHP

Định nghĩa và cách sử dụng

Số nguyên PHP

  • Int type integer (viết tắt là int) is integer integer
  • is not a compile number
  • Có ít nhất 1 ký tự
  • value is in interval. -2.147.483.648 và 2.147.483.647

Php viết

// var_dump trả về kiểu dữ liệu và giá trị.
?>

GÁN DỮ SANG INTERGER

Constructor. (int)$tenbien

// $x đang ở dạng chuỗi.
$x = (int)$x;
var_dump($x);
?>

KIỂM TRA DUYỆT OISE INTERGER HAY KHÔNG

Constructor.

$var = null;
if (is_null($var)) {
	echo 'biến mang giá trị rỗng';
}else{
	echo 'biến mang giá trị khác rỗng';
}
8 hoặc
$var = null;
if (is_null($var)) {
	echo 'biến mang giá trị rỗng';
}else{
	echo 'biến mang giá trị khác rỗng';
}
9, nếu dữ liệu đúng là kiểu interger thì kết quả trả về là true, không phải thì kết quả trả về là false

// $x đang ở dạng chuỗi.
$x = is_int($x);
var_dump($x);
?>

Phao PHP

Kiểu dữ liệu float là kiểu số thực, là dạng số thập phân hoặc dạng tích lũy

Php viết

FLOAT GÁN DẪN SANG KEXP

Constructor.

biến mang giá trị rỗng
0

biến mang giá trị khác rỗng
0

KIỂM TRA DUYỆT OIRES KERS FLOAT HAY NOT

Constructor.

biến mang giá trị rỗng
1, nếu dữ liệu đúng là kiểu float thì kết quả trả về là true, không phải thì kết quả trả về là false

biến mang giá trị khác rỗng
1

Chuỗi PHP

Chuỗi dữ liệu kiểu là chuỗi ký tự dạng chuỗi, được chứa bên trong dấu ngoặc đơn hoặc dấu ngoặc kép

Php viết

biến mang giá trị khác rỗng
2

string(22) "Học web chuẩn 2011"
string(22) "Học web chuẩn 2011"

GÁN DẪN XUẤT SANG STRING

Constructor.

biến mang giá trị rỗng
2

biến mang giá trị khác rỗng
3

KIỂM TRUY CẬP DUYỆT CÁC CÂU HỎI KIỂU CHUỖI CHUỖI HAY KHÔNG

Constructor.

biến mang giá trị rỗng
3, nếu dữ liệu đúng là kiểu chuỗi thì kết quả trả về là true, không phải thì kết quả trả về là false

biến mang giá trị khác rỗng
4

Tham khảo thêm các chuỗi hàm thường dùng

Mảng PHP

Kiểu dữ liệu mảng là kiểu dữ liệu lưu trữ nhiều giá trị trong một biến duy nhất

Php viết

biến mang giá trị khác rỗng
5

mảng(4) { [0]=> chuỗi(4) "html" [1]=> chuỗi(3) "css" [2]=> chuỗi(6) "jquery" [3]=> int(1024)

THÀNH PHẦN TỬA ARRAY

  • Mảng phần tử được đánh chỉ mục từ 0 trở đi, tức phần tử đầu tiên sẽ được xem là phần tử 0
  • Cách viết một mảng phần tử.
    biến mang giá trị rỗng
    4, with
    biến mang giá trị rỗng
    5 is an array number index
biến mang giá trị khác rỗng
6

Ta thấy kết quả của chỉ mục 0 chính là phần tử đầu tiên trong mảng

KIỂM TRA DUYỆT OIRRAY ARRAY HAY NOT

Constructor.

biến mang giá trị rỗng
6, nếu dữ liệu đúng là kiểu mảng thì kết quả trả về là true, không phải thì kết quả trả về là false

biến mang giá trị khác rỗng
7

Tham khảo thêm các kiểu dữ liệu mảng

Tham khảo thêm các mảng hàm thường dùng

Boolean PHP

Kiểu dữ liệu boolean là kiểu dữ liệu đại diện cho 2 trạng thái đúng (true) và sai (false)

Boolean thường được sử dụng để kiểm tra điều kiện kiểm tra

Cấu trúc.
______77

Giá trị đúng và sai không phân biệt viết hoa hay viết thường. TRUE = đúng, FALSE = sai

biến mang giá trị khác rỗng
8

GÁN DẪN XUẤT SANG BOOLEAN

Có 2 cấu trúc.
______78

biến mang giá trị khác rỗng
9

KIỂM TRA DUYỆT OIRRERS BOOLESE HAY KHÔNG

Constructor.

biến mang giá trị rỗng
9, nếu dữ liệu đúng là kiểu boolean thì kết quả trả về là true, không phải thì kết quả trả về là false

$var = null;
if (is_null($var)) {
	echo 'biến mang giá trị rỗng';
}else{
	echo 'biến mang giá trị khác rỗng';
}
0

Đối tượng PHP

Đối tượng là một kiểu dữ liệu lưu trữ dữ liệu và thông tin của đối tượng

Sẽ được nhắc đến chi tiết ở phần hướng đối tượng sau

Đầu tiên phải khai báo lớp của đối tượng (lớp), lớp là cấu trúc chứa thuộc tính (thuộc tính) và phương thức (phương thức)